Full Cost Breakdown

Thessaloniki — Full Breakdown
1BR Apartment (Centre)€475/mo
1BR Apartment (Outside)€400/mo
3BR Apartment (Centre)€1,045/mo
3BR Apartment (Outside)€732/mo
Groceries (Single)€351/mo
Monthly Transport Pass€84/mo
Utilities (85m² Flat)€168/mo
Internet€35/mo
Health Insurance (Single)€70/mo
Entertainment & Dining€112/mo
Total Single (Centre)€1,403/mo
Total Single (Outside)€1,193/mo
Total Family of 4 (Centre)€2,500/mo
Total Family of 4 (Outside)€2,125/mo
Student Budget€912/mo

Compared to Country Average

CategoryThessalonikiGreece AvgDifference
1BR Rent (Centre)€475€637-25% below avg
Total Single (Centre)€1,403€1,708-18% below avg
Total Family (Centre)€2,500€2,919-14% below avg
Groceries€351€427-18% below avg
Transport€84€102-18% below avg

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does it cost to live in Thessaloniki in 2026?

A single expat living in central Thessaloniki should budget approximately €1,403 per month, covering rent, groceries, transport, utilities, healthcare, and entertainment. A family of four needs around €2,500/month.

How much is rent in Thessaloniki for expats?

A 1-bedroom apartment in Thessaloniki city centre costs around €475/month. Outside the centre, expect to pay approximately €400/month. A 3-bedroom apartment in the centre is around €1,045/month.
